Shaw, Saint Louis, MO demographics:
population, income, and more
Shaw population
How many people live in Shaw
Shaw is home to 1,608 residents, according to the most recent Census data. Gender-wise, 47.2% of Shaw locals are male, and 52.8% are female.
Age demographics
The median age in Shaw is 35, with the population distributed as follows: about 14.7% are children under 15, then 9.2% are in the 15 to 24 age group. Adults between 25 and 44 make up 43.2% of the population, while another 21.6% fall into the 45 to 64 bracket. Finally, around 11.4% are 65 or older.
Racial makeup
In Shaw, 92.4% of the population are US-born citizens, while 4.8% have gained naturalized citizenship. At the same time, 2.9% of residents are non-citizens. As for race, 66.7% of locals are Caucasian, 20.8% are African American and 3.2% have Asian roots. Another 0.1% are Indigenous American, 0.1% are Pacific Islanders, while 0.9% identify as another race. There’s also a share of 8.2% that includes residents with two or more races.
Households in Shaw
A peek inside Shaw households
Shaw has 834 households, with an average of 2 members in each. Of these, 41.7% are families, while the remaining 58.3% are made up of individuals living alone or with non-relatives, such as roommates.

Housing in Shaw
The housing landscape of Shaw
Shaw's housing consists of 947 units, with 45.5% being detached single-family homes ideal for those wanting space. Attached options, including duplexes and townhouses, make up 2.6% and offer a more compact, shared living style. Then there are the multifamily buildings in the area, and for those seeking flexibility, non-traditional options like mobile homes account for 0.1% of the housing landscape.
The age of buildings in Shaw
In Shaw, the median construction year is 1938. About 59.4% of homes were built before the 1940s, with another 2.8% going up by 1949. Most development happened in the second half of the 20th century. Then, 8.7% of homes were added from 2000 to 2009, 13.6% between 2010 and 2019, and 1.8% are part of the newest wave of development.
Shaw occupancy rates
Out of the 834 occupied housing units in Shaw, 43.6% are owner-occupied, while 56.5% are lived in by tenants. Meanwhile, 11.9% of all homes on the local market sit vacant.
Shaw housing costs
Housing costs in Shaw come to a median of $1,366 per month, while tenants specifically pay a median gross rent of $1,240.
Education in Shaw
Shaw education at a glance
About 17.2% of the population in Shaw went to high school, while 13.3% pursued college studies. Another 5.8% earned an associate degree and 33.1% hold a bachelor’s. Meanwhile, 29.8% went even further, earning a master’s or doctorate.
Income in Shaw
How much people earn in Shaw
The average annual household income in Shaw was $108,003 in 2024, the most recent annual data available, according to the U.S. Census Bureau. This marked a +8.5% change from the previous year. At the same time, the median income stood at $81,655, reflecting a +10.6% shift over the same period.
Shaw income by age
In Shaw, households led by residents aged 25 to 44 — usually in the early to mid stages of their careers — have a median income of $101,989. Those with someone between 45 and 64 in charge, often well established professionally, earn $78,520 overall. Younger households, where the main provider is under 25 and just starting out, report a median income of $41,688, while those led by someone over 65, many of whom may be retired, have about $56,719 in earnings. Overall, 91.4% of the locals in this community live above the poverty line.
Employment in Shaw
Workforce and job types in Shaw
90.6% of the working population are employed in professional or administrative positions, while 9.4% are in hands-on or service-based jobs. Also, 7% run their own businesses, 60.5% are employed by private companies, and 9% work in the public sector.
